11/1/21 –NEC Corporation has been contracted by Facebook to build an ultra-high performance transatlantic subsea fiber-optic cable connecting the U.S. and Europe, a plan that calls for capacity of up to a petabit per second.

A press release said that, until recently, subsea cable was composed of 16 fiber pairs at most. Now, using NEC’s newly developed 24-fiber pair cable and repeaters, a system can deliver a maximum transmission capacity of a half petabit per second, the highest to date for a long-distance “repeatered” optical subsea cable system. That performance represents a 50% improvement in fiber count over the 16-fiber pair systems.

Per Teleography, Facebook has a stake in 13 cables. Google has an ownership stake in at least 16 current or planned undersea cables around the world. It noted that the internet giants are the ones leading undersea cable development, displacing traditional telecom giants.

Of note, OCC, an NEC subsidiary, previously reported in March that its 24 fiber pair cable can be manufactured using a wide range of existing optical fibers, according to the needs of each new cable system. International data usage across the Atlantic is expected to expand twenty-fold in the 15 years between 2021 and 2035. The region ranks among the highest growth geographies for data traffic demand, bringing ever-greater demands to reduce the cost per bit on subsea cable networks.

Japan’s NEC Corporation has signed a contract with the National Submarine Cable Utility Belau Submarine Cable Corporation (BSCC) of the Palau Republic (Palau) for the Palau Cable 2 (PC2) cable construction project.

A press release said that PC2, with a total length of approximately 110 km, will connect Palau with the Southeast Asia–United States (SEA–US) cable that connects Southeast Asia and the U.S. mainland. BSCC, a state-owned public corporation, owns and manages a submarine fiber optic cable network for Palau. This cable is scheduled to be completed by the end of 2022.

PC2 adopts the latest optical wavelength multiplexing transmission system of 100 gigabits per second (100 Gbps). An addition to the first optical submarine cable laid by NEC in Palau in 2017, it ensures the redundancy of Palau’s network, reliable communications and the increasing demands for communications.

The Republic of Palau consists of eight principal islands and more than 250 smaller ones lying roughly 500 miles southeast of the Philippines, in Oceania. The islands of Palau constitute the westernmost part of the Caroline Islands chain. Its total land area is 177 sq mi.

Per a report in Total Telecom, in 2017, NEC began construction of three submarine cables in Micronesia, to connect the islands of Palau, Yap, and Chuuk with the SEA–US cable. NEC notes that its OCC Corporation subsidiary makes submarine optical cables able to withstand water pressure 8,000 meters beneath the sea.

NEC has won a contract from Okinawa Cellular Telephone Company to supply an optical submarine cable system connecting Okinawa Prefecture and Kagoshima Prefecture in Japan to be in operation in April 2020. 

A press release said that NEC will provide the optical submarine cable system as a turnkey solution. The cable will be manufactured by NEC’s subsidiary OCC Corporation, which it noted is the only company in Japan that can make optical submarine cables capable of withstanding the water pressure from 8,000 m deep seas.

The cable system will be connected to Nago City, Okinawa Prefecture, and Hioki City, Kagoshima Prefecture, with a total length of approximately 760 km and at a maximum depth of approximately 1,200 m. The system will employ the latest optical wavelength multiplex transmission method, with maximum design transmission capacity of 80 Tbps.

NEC, as a system integrator, will provides all aspects of submarine cable operations, including the optical transmission terminal stations, optical submarine repeaters, optical submarine cables, ocean surveys and route designs, installation of equipment and cable, and training and delivery testing.
